Create a range selection by dragging with the mouse in list views

Dragging with the left button held now extends the selection from the
pressed line, exactly like moving with shift+up/down does. We use the
non-sticky flavor so that the range collapses on the next plain cursor
movement, again matching the keyboard behavior.

The binding is only registered for contexts that support range selection
in the first place; dragging in other lists continues to do nothing.
